CAA Framing Guidelines

 

The following general framing requirements apply to all CAA shows. In addition, some venues and shows may have specific requirements such as type of frame and positioning of hanging wire.

  1. Works on paper must be matted and framed or firmly adhered to cradled wood panels with no loose edges.
     

  2. No glass in frames. Museum or archival quality plexiglass is recommended. For pastel or graphite works on paper, look for anti-static plexiglass. Locally, TAP Plastics carries this type of plexiglass.
     

  3. Only wire is accepted for hanging. All 2D or 3D art pieces designed to be hung must have a wire attached to the frame with D-rings. Wire must be of sufficient gauge to bear the weight of the art piece. No exceptions!
     

  4. Wire must be affixed in such a way that when the piece is hung from either one or two nails, the wire does not show.
     

  5. All frames must be presentable. This means clean, dust-free, and undamaged. Corners must be square with no loose frame corners.
     

  6. Works on canvas should be framed unless the canvas is gallery-wrapped. In that case, the sides must be painted.
     

  7. All art pieces must include a label on the upper left back corner with:

  • Artist Name

  • Title

  • Media

  • Price

  • Artist contact information
